Reflection

Dear friends,   Today I want to open with something I wrote in my journal:

                         “Lord, I feel faint. I feel like running. I wasn’t heard today, and it hurt.”

That’s the raw truth of trauma recovery. Some days, the weight of despair makes you want to run away, hide, or simply give up. There are moments when you feel invisible, ignored, or dismissed — when your pain doesn’t seem to matter to the people around you.

But even when others fail to hear us, God does not turn away.

He whispers into the storm: “Be still. I will fight for you.”

5 Brave Tips for Day 5 🌱

  1. Pause instead of running – When you feel the urge to flee, take a breath and invite God to fight for you.

  2. Write out a scripture – Handwriting God’s Word anchors it deeper in your soul. Try Exodus 14:14 today.

  3. Name your hurt honestly – Journal the words: “I wasn’t heard today, and it hurt.” Naming pain reduces its power.

  4. Choose one truth to hold – Pick one scripture from today’s readings to repeat when fear rises.

  5. Affirm your belief – Declare: “I still believe in God, in myself, and in the talents He gave me.”

Crisis Resources 📞

If you are in danger or need help, please reach out:

  • National Domestic Violence Hotline: 1-800-799-SAFE (7233)

  • National Suicide Prevention Lifeline: Dial 988

  • RAINN Sexual Assault Hotline: 1-800-656-HOPE (4673)

You are not alone. There is hope.
